What is BIS Registration?
BIS Registration is a certification process managed by the Bureau of Indian Standards to ensure that products meet Indian quality and safety standards. Depending on the product category, businesses may need:
BIS CRS Registration
ISI Mark Certification
FMCS Certification
Scheme X Certification
Certificate of Conformity (CoC)
Obtaining the correct certification is mandatory for several products before they can be manufactured, imported, or sold in India.
Why is BIS Registration Challenging?
Although the process may appear straightforward, many businesses encounter difficulties because of:
Technical documentation requirements
Product testing at BIS-recognized laboratories
Incorrect application forms
Frequent regulatory updates
Delays in responding to BIS queries
Compliance with Indian Standards (IS Codes)
Even a small mistake in documentation can delay approval by several weeks or even months.

3. Which products require BIS registration?
Many products require BIS registration, including electronics, electrical appliances, LED lighting products, batteries, toys, cement, chemicals, and various industrial products, depending on applicable BIS regulations.
